Azerbaijan, Baku, Oct 17 /Trend E.Ismayilov/
Azerkimya Production Unit (production of chemical products) of the State Oil Company of Azerbaijan (SOCAR) produced 20,3 thousand tons of polyethylene during Jan-Sept 2012, which is 47.5 percent more compared to the same period of 2011, Azerbaijani State Statistics Committee told Trend.
